Trees That Count mobilises businesses, planters, and individuals to restore Aotearoa’s unique biodiversity, take action on climate risk and grow a brighter future through the planting of millions of native trees. We connect businesses and donors to planting projects around the country to accelerate their mahi. With support to every corner of the country we help organisations looking for a genuine way to make a demonstrable, positive impact on the environment in the regions they operate in, or at a national level. Trees That Count grew from the Project Crimson Trust, an environment charity that has been at the forefront of community restoration in Aotearoa since 1990.
